The Cycling Breakaway Calculator uses Professor Hendrik Van Maldeghem's mathematical formula from Ghent University to predict whether a breakaway group will succeed or be caught by the peloton. The Van Maldeghem formula accounts for fatigue dynamics based on the number of breakaway riders. Fewer riders tire faster, making them easier to catch, while groups of 10 or more can sustain their speed similarly to the peloton. The formula calculates both the distance (in kilometers) and the time (in minutes) needed for the peloton to catch the breakaway. An optional remaining race distance input lets you determine whether the breakaway will survive to the finish line. The formula is most accurate on flat stages and does not account for variables like wind direction, road gradient, teamwork dynamics, or the tactical decision of the peloton to let the breakaway go. What is a cycling breakaway?

A cycling breakaway occurs when one or more riders separate from the main group (peloton) during a race. Riders break away to win individual stages, gain time on rivals in mountain stages, or secure classification jerseys. Breakaway specialists are skilled riders who excel at these moves.

How does the Van Maldeghem formula work?

Professor Hendrik Van Maldeghem of Ghent University developed a formula that predicts the distance the peloton needs to catch a breakaway. It accounts for the number of riders in the breakaway, the time gap, and the speeds of both groups. The formula is: distance_needed = time_gap × peloton_speed × (6 × peloton_speed / (3 × (peloton_speed - sprinter_speed) + √(6 × peloton_speed × time_gap × (10 - riders) + 9 × (peloton_speed - sprinter_speed)²)) - 1).

How does the number of riders affect the outcome?

Fewer riders in the breakaway means fatigue sets in faster, making it easier for the peloton to catch them. With 10 or more riders, the formula assumes the breakaway group can sustain speed like the peloton, requiring significantly more distance to catch. This matches real-world racing dynamics where large breakaway groups are harder to bring back.

What happens if the breakaway is faster than the peloton?

If the breakaway speed equals or exceeds the peloton speed, the breakaway will never be caught (assuming constant speeds). The calculator displays "Never caught" for the distance needed. If you have entered a remaining race distance, the result will show the breakaway as succeeding.

What is a peloton in cycling?

A peloton is the main group of cyclists in a race. Most riders prefer to stay in the peloton because it offers advantages like reduced aerodynamic drag (drafting), shared pacing responsibilities, and tactical support from teammates. The peloton works together to chase down breakaways or control the race pace.

How accurate is the Van Maldeghem formula?

The formula has been tested on numerous real races and proved surprisingly accurate for flat stages. However, it does not account for wind conditions, road gradients, teamwork dynamics, or tactical considerations. On hilly or mountainous terrain, actual catch distances may differ significantly from the calculated value.

What is a breakaway specialist in professional cycling?

A breakaway specialist is a rider whose primary role is to join or initiate breakaways from the start of a race. These riders often target stage wins, King of the Mountains classification, or the most combative rider award. Famous breakaway specialists include Thomas De Gendt, Jens Voigt, and Sylvain Chavanel, known for their long solo efforts.
